TP官方网址下载_tp官方下载安卓最新版本/中文版/苹果版/tpwallet
下面以“TokenPocket 如何创建 FIL(Filecoin)并完成智能支付”为主线,围绕你提到的几个主题做深入讲解。你可以把它当作一份从入门到进阶的操作指南与技术视角集合。
一、TokenPocket 中创建 FIL 的前置理解
1)你要先明确:TokenPocket 不是“挖矿平台”,而是“多链钱包与链上交互入口”。创建 FIL,本质是:
- 在 TokenPocket 里为 Filecoin 网络创建/导入一个地址。
- 通过链上交易或智能合约交互来完成资产管理与支付。
2)FIL 相关要点:
- Filecoin 网络通常分为主网与测试网。你要根据需求选择对应网络。
- 地址体系与网络链 ID/ RPC 配置相关,TokenPocket 会提供对应链路。
二、账户创建:如何在 TokenPocket 准备好 FIL 地址
下面给出两条常见路径:创建新钱包 或 导入已有钱包。 路径 A:创建新钱包(适合第一次使用) 1)打开 TokenPocket,进入“钱包/我的”。 2)选择“创建钱包”。 3)设置安全选项: - 备份助记词(强烈建议离线保存)。 - 设置钱包密码/生物识别(视你设备而定)。 4)完成创建后,进入“资产/添加链”。 5)找到 Filecoin(FIL)并添加。 6)检查地址: - 确认网络为 Filecoin。 - 复制地址用于接收 FIL 或后续链上交互。 路径 B:导入已有钱包(适合已有助记词) 1)TokenPocket 选择“导入钱包”。 2)按流程填写助记词或私钥。 3)导入成功后,添加 Filecoin 链。 4)检查是否显示对应 FIL 地址,确认网络与链配置正确。 关键检查清单(建议你每次都做): - 地址是否正确(复制到浏览器核对)。 - 网络是否为主网/测试网(尤其是做合约时)。 - 余额是否存在(交易费与转账费依赖链上代币/燃料机制)。 三、进入高速交易处理:把“体验”做快的核心思路 高速交易处理并不是“提高链速”,而是通过钱包交互与链上策略降低等待时间与失败率。 1)减少无效交易: - 在发送前校验:收款地址、金额、精度单位(FIL 有最小单位),以及 memo/备注字段。 - 确保账户余额覆盖:转账金额 + 网络交易费(gas/执行费用)。 2)更合理的交易节奏: - 如果你在做频繁转账或支付聚合,建议使用批处理思路(先组装待签名/再统一广播),减少多次重复等待。 - 对于确认速度敏感的场景,尽量选择链上确认策略更稳妥的广播方式。 3)应对链上拥堵: - 当链拥堵时,交易失败/延迟概率上升。 - 做法:在 TokenPocket 中查看是否可调交易费率/优先级(若界面支持),或更换发送时机。 4)安全与效率并重: - 大额或高频交易建议先小额试单。 - 对于企业支付场景,通常会有“链上签名服务 + 交易队列 + 回执回传”的工程化方案,而钱包只是交互端。 四、智能支付接口:从“转账”到“可编排支付”的能力 “智能支付接口”可以理解为:让支付过程具备条件、规则或自动执行能力。 1)传统支付: - 仅靠转账:你输入金额与地址,链上执行一次简单转账。 2)智能支付: - 你引入合约或链上逻辑:例如在达成条件时释放资金、到期自动退还、分账/结算、支付分段里程碑等。 3)在 TokenPocket 里落地的方式(概念层): - 你可以通过 TokenPocket 的 DApp/合约交互入口完成调用。 - 常见交互流程: a. 打开相关 DApp 或合约页面。 b. 选择网络与合约。 c. 填写参数(收款人、金额、条件、期限等)。 d. 确认交易、签名并广播。 4)智能支付的工程化建议: - 参数校验要严格:防止金额精度错误、地址输入错误。 - 交易回执处理:要能追踪状态(已广播/已上链/已确认/失败原因)。 - 事件监听:当合约发出支付事件时,系统回传给业务侧。 五、技术见解:FIL 交互的关键“技术观察点” 1)链上费用与重试策略 - 交易失败常见原因:余额不足、nonce/序列问题、合约参数错误。 - 对策:在钱包端或后端记录交易状态,失败后不要无限重发;先解析失败原因再调整。 2)地址与合约交互的差异 - 普通转账:只需要收款地址与金额。 - 合约调用:还需要 ABI/函数参数、gas 估算(或手动设置)、以及正确的合约地址。 3)签名与隐私边界 - 钱包签名通常发生在本地设备。 - 对企业级“接口化支付”,通常会将签名能力抽象为服务(例如签名器),但私钥管理要极致谨慎。 4)可用性与观测性 - 高速支付系统必须有“可观测性”:交易 hash、状态变迁、错误码、重试次数、平均确认时延。 六、高科技创新趋势:钱包到支付平台的演进方向 1)多链钱包的统一资产与统一交互 - 用户体验会从“分别操作每条链”演进到“同一界面完成多链支付”。 - FIL 将更频繁地作为价值通道之一被集成。 2)账户抽象/智能账户(趋势) - 未来可能出现更灵活的“账户逻辑”:允许批量操作、条件签名、自动补手续费等。 3)支付即服务(Payment-as-a-Service) - 将智能支付从合约层抽象为 API:创建订单、生成签名参数、回调通知。 - 钱包端只做签名与交互,业务端通过接口管理全流程。 4)链上支付的合规与风控 - 链上透明但并不等于“无需风控”。未来系统会把黑名单、限额、审计日志等与链上事件结合。 七、数字化未来世界:TokenPocket + FIL 的可能应用场景 1)Web3 供应链结算 - 里程碑付款、自动释放、对账透明。 2)跨境微支付与内容付费 - 低成本、可编排的支付策略更适合按次或按服务计费。 3)游戏/数字资产生态 - 交易快速确认、可编排的奖励与结算。 4)金融化资产的链上托管与分配 - 通过智能合约实现更细粒度的权益分配与自动结算。 八、代码仓库:你可以如何组织“创建 FIL 与智能支付”的工程 你提到“代码仓库”,下面给出一个合理的仓库结构建议(偏模板化)。你可以用它来规划前后端工程。 建议仓库结构(示例): - /docs - how-to-create-fil.md(TokenPocket 创建/导入 FIL 的步骤说明) - smart-payments.md(智能支付交互流程) - /contracts - SmartPayment.sol(示例合约:可按条件释放资金) - MultiRecipientPayment.sol(示例:分账/多收款) - /backend - tx-queue.js(交易队列:批量签名/广播/回执) - relayer.js(中继:负责与链交互,注意权限与安全) - webhook-handler.js(支付回调处理) - /frontend - payment-ui(支付页面:收款方、金额、条件参数填写) - wallet-connector(与 TokenPocket/DApp 交互的适配层) - /scripts - deploy.js(合约部署脚本) - estimate-gas.js(gas 估算与检查) - /tests - integration.spec.js(集成测试:交易成功路径与失败路径) - README.md(总览:如何运行、如何配置网络与环境变量) 九、把“步骤”落到实践的最小闭环(建议你照着做) 1)在 TokenPocket 创建或导入钱包。 2)添加 Filecoin(FIL)网络,拿到地址。 3)先进行一次小额转账验证: - 确认地址无误、余额覆盖费用。 - 获取交易 hash,核对确认情况。 4)再尝试智能支付: - 打开对应 DApp/合约页面(或你自己的合约测试页面)。 - 用最简单的参数调用一个支付函数。 - 等事件/回执确认,再进入下一步。 5)建立工程化记录: - 保存每笔交易的 hash、输入参数摘要、失败原因。 - 把这些写入日志或数据库,形成可审计的流水。 如果你希望我进一步“更贴近可操作”的细化,我可以按你的实际目标继续: - 你是要在主网还是测试网? - 你是想做“普通转账”还是“合约条件支付”(例如分期/到期/托管释放)? - 你是否需要我给出合约示例结构(Solidity/或 Filecoin 生态对应语言与接口层)以及仓库模板代码清单? 只要你回答这三个问题,我就能把这份讲解升级成更具体的步骤与可复用代码框架。
